<p>I don’t trust people who aren’t on Facebook.</p>
<p><img title="facebook.jpg" src="http://collegecandy.files.wordpress.com//2009/03/03/facebook.jpg?w=404&amp;h=303" alt="facebook.jpg" width="404" height="303" />It’s weird, I know, but FB is like peanut butter and jelly: you must be some sort of freak if you’ve never tried it. (OK, or you have some severe allergy, but that doesn’t fit with my analogy so let’s move on.) Facebook is at the epicenter of our generation’s world, so anyone who isn’t on there is weird, right? I mean, how do you live without Facebook?</p>
<p>How do you learn about people?<br />
See pictures?<br />
Know what’s going on in your friends’ lives?!<br />
Update everyone on your own life without tons and tons of phone calls?</p>
<p>But maybe I’m not so weird for feeling this way. <a href="http://www.telegraph.co.uk/technology/facebook/6120610/Failing-to-disclose-private-life-on-Facebook-is-social-suicide.html">Matthew Myron</a>, an author who recently studied online privacy, has gone as far as saying that not being on Facebook is social suicide. ”Many people feel they have to be a part of Facebook to socialize. Such sites are the modern equivalent of a mobile phone. They have grown into fashion accessories and they are a must-have for people who don’t want to be social outcasts.”</p>
<p>Myron speaks mostly in regards to status updates and wall posts, but his point is even truer than he knows. When people have parties, they invite guests via Facebook. When people have birthdays, we send them messages (and are notified!) via Facebook. When people have anything to say, we say it all on Facebook.</p>
<p>And when someone doesn’t have Facebook, we think they are <span style="text-decoration: line-through;">freaks</span> hiding something.</p>
<p>Are those things even replacements for in-person chats or phone conversations?  Is someone’s profile a fair way to judge them? Probably not, but that is how we roll in “generation me” and anyone who is not a part of that will be left behind and out of the know when it comes to weekend ragers.</p>
<p>We may not want to admit it, but Facebook is a huge part of (and maybe the basis of) our social lives in college. <p>Yesterday we published <a href="http://www.collegecandy.com/wired/14311">this story</a> about some high-profile individuals who lost their jobs because of some unruly Facebook activity. If you’re thinking to yourself, “uh-oh, I love partying and taking pictures to post on Facebook, but I kind of want to have a job one day,” relax. You <em>can</em> have your cake and eat it, too.  Just make sure you’re utilizing all the appropriate privacy settings.  There are several steps to take to ensure your safety online, so just follow these tips!</p>
<p><strong>1. Make all of your photos “Friends Only”</strong></p>
<p>Tempting as it may be to leave photos up, it’s much safer to make them “Friends Only.” That way you know for certain who has access to your pictures. To do this, go <a href="http://www.facebook.com/privacy/?view=search#/privacy/?view=profile">here</a> and under the option “Photos tagged of you,” click the drop-down menu and select “Only Friends.”</p>
<p align="left">You should also do the same for Videos of You and all of your own photo albums (just click “Edit Photo Albums Privacy Settings” next to the”Photos Tagged of You” option). Even if you don’t tag your own photos, they’re still visible to anyone who has access to your profile.  By making your photos “Friends Only,” you don’t run the risk of having potential employers stumbling upon that glorious shot of you flipping the bird while sucking down a 40. Which brings me to the next point…</p>
<p><strong>2. Make your profile private (or at least disable some applications).</strong></p>
<p><strong></strong>Everyone’s a Facebook stalker, no matter if they’re a potential employer or a potential boyfriend. So while it may seem appealing to allow Mr. Hot Stuff to view your profile and read from your wall posts that you had such a great time at the bars last weekend, you can’t trust that a future boss will have the same enthused reaction. And most Facebook users  have their profiles set so that other people in their networks can see them. So if you belong to a regional network (especially in big cities like New York, LA, DC, and Boston), remember that <em>anyone</em> can join and belong to them, too.  So to control what information people see when they search you, go <a href="http://www.facebook.com/privacy/?view=search#/privacy/?view=profile">here</a> and under the options “Profile” and “Wall Posts” click the drop-down menu and select “Only Friends.” You should consider doing the same for your Basic Info, Personal Info, and Status Updates as well (particularly if you list under “Interests” all of your favorite rums…). Even if you have a tame profile for the most part, you never know when a friend might post a questionable comment or YouTube video on your wall. Better to be safe than sorry.</p>
<p align="left"><strong>3. Choose your default wisely!</strong></p>
<p><strong></strong>All of these new privacy settings would mean nothing if the Big Kahuna, your default Facebook photo, isn’t family-friendly. Save the sexy memories of Halloween (yes you looked cute as a hot nurse)  for your newly-protected other photos, and choose a default that is flattering but not reputation-damaging. If the default-in-question features ANYONE (even if it’s not you) drinking, inappropriately dressed, making obscene gestures and/or alluding to racist/sexist materia, ditch it! Furthermore, make sure to go into your Profile Picture album and delete any questionable defaults from the past. If your settings enable anyone on Facebook to view your default when they search for you, it’s possible they can view any of your past default photos (since Facebook automatically saves them into that album).</p>
<p align="left"><strong>4. Remove personal information that can potentially enable identity theft.</strong></p>
<p><strong></strong>Being wary of potential employers isn’t the only reason to keep your profile clean. Identity theft is a real and scary part of the world these days–and most of the information used by theives can be found on a typical Facebook profile! <em>Never</em> publish the year you were born (the month and day is okay, but not foolproof), your address, and your phone number all at once. This information makes it much easier for scammers to open credit cards in your name, or at least track you down and possibly go through your trash (ALWAYS cut up or shred discarded mail).</p>
<p align="left"><strong>5. Don’t make your Facebook searchable on Google!</strong>Nowadays, it’s possible for your Facebook to be viewed even by people who do not have Facebook. Don’t believe me? Type your name as it appears on Facebook into Google and see if your profile shows up. If it does (and even if it doesn’t) follow <a href="http://www.facebook.com/privacy/?view=search">this link</a> to disable Facebook from making your profile searchable on the internet (<em>unclick</em> the “Create a public search listing” box). Not only can potential employers find you this way, but so can mom and dad, nana and papa, and…yeah, the whole free world.</p>
